Transaction fc08d0491e830df85d73fe4ac219e02dba732ecd9e5c6e5f322d1bdf94ceba39

63 Input
2 Outputs
  • fc08d0491e830df85d73fe4ac219e02dba732ecd9e5c6e5f322d1bdf94ceba39:0
  • value  506824106
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• fc08d0491e830df85d73fe4ac219e02dba732ecd9e5c6e5f322d1bdf94ceba39:1
  • value  1223203
    address  38wZN3FAU9WMMHUZJbxMeG8725CDheSKQQ